The primary driver for seeking a "fanuc roboguide v640 rev e crack" is usually the high cost of industrial software licenses. Small-scale integrators or students may feel priced out of the official market. However, "cracked" versions of specialized engineering tools rarely provide the stability required for professional environments. Given the risks, it's essential to understand the legal and ethical landscape. Using a crack constitutes software piracy, which is a clear violation of FANUC's licensing agreement and intellectual property rights. This exposure carries potential legal consequences for individuals and companies, including fines. Furthermore, ethical standards within the engineering profession demand that we respect the software and the developers who create the professional tools we rely on.
